// Heads up, new folks: this backoff cap exists because of the great
// Pondwick websocket meltdown. Clients used to reconnect instantly,
// hammering the Fernhall gateway into a retry storm every time it
// blipped. Don't lower this without talking to the realtime crew —
// we learned this one the hard way. The build where the fix first
// shipped is noted below.

build token for tawip-yageg: htk9_92ac43d42

Build provenance — Pixelwash EXIF scrubber. Every image passing through the Marrowbay upload path is scrubbed of EXIF metadata by the Pixelwash stage before storage. Support can confirm a customer's file was processed by checking the provenance record attached to the upload. The scrubber build that produced the current pipeline is stamped below.

session token of tajef-bageg = htk21_5d90d574934f3ccae6437

Onboarding note for the Brindlewick support rotation: some customers on the Fenholt region report intermittent DNS resolution failures against our Loomgate resolver pool. Symptoms are NXDOMAIN responses for valid hostnames, clearing within 60 seconds. Before escalating, confirm the resolver pool version, capture dig output, and note the exact timestamp — the cache layer logs rotate hourly. Escalations go to the Netweave team. To access the diagnostics console after a lockout, use the recovery passphrase, which is noted directly below.

vault phrase of tajef-tafog = istox-sorax-zorox-casok-holox-kelix-weneth-drueth-casion